How much do travel rcis jobs pay per week?

As of Sep 12, 2026, the average weekly pay for travel rcis in Atlanta, GA is $2,469.88,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$2,107.69 and $2,821.15 per week,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Travel RCIS?

A Travel RCIS (Registered Cardiovascular Invasive Specialist) job involves working in different healthcare facilities on temporary assignments to assist with cardiac catheterization procedures, angioplasties, and other cardiovascular interventions. Travel RCIS professionals help medical teams by preparing equipment, monitoring patients, and documenting procedures. These roles offer flexibility, competitive pay, and opportunities to gain experience in various clinical settings nationwide.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Travel RCIS position?

To thrive as a Travel RCIS (Registered Cardiovascular Invasive Specialist), you need a solid background in cardiovascular procedures, patient care, and typically an associate degree in cardiovascular technology or related field, along with RCIS certification. Familiarity with imaging equipment, hemodynamic monitoring systems, and electronic health records is essential for daily operations. Strong communication, adaptability, and teamwork skills are crucial, especially in diverse clinical environments where rapid decision-making is required. These competencies ensure safe, high-quality patient care and effective collaboration within varied healthcare teams while on assignment at different facilities.

What is the typical work environment and team structure for a Travel RCIS?

As a Travel RCIS, you will usually be placed in hospital catheterization labs or cardiac care units, working alongside cardiologists, nurses, and other invasive specialists. Assignments can vary in length, but you'll often integrate quickly into established teams and adapt to local protocols and equipment. The pace can be fast and intense, especially during emergent procedures, but you will have opportunities to expand your experience by working in different settings and learning from multiple healthcare teams. Collaboration and communication are vital to ensure patient safety and high-quality care in each new environment.
